ASP.NET 登录页面:用户与管理员的权限划分
ASP.NET是微软开发的一种基于.NET Framework的Web应用程序框架,广泛应用于企业级Web应用程序的开发。在ASP.NET中,登录页面是一个非常重要的组成部分,它不仅负责用户身份验证,还需要根据不同用户角色提供相应的功能和权限。本文将为您详细介绍如何在ASP.NET中实现用户和管理员的登录页面,并对两种角色的权限进行合理划分。
用户登录页面
对于普通用户来说,登录页面通常包含用户名和密码两个输入框,以及登录按钮。在后台,ASP.NET提供了丰富的身份验证机制,开发者可以根据实际需求选择合适的方式进行身份验证。常见的身份验证方式包括表单身份验证、Windows身份验证、声明式身份验证等。
在完成用户身份验证后,系统需要根据用户的角色为其分配相应的权限。这可以通过角色管理功能实现,开发者可以预先定义好不同的角色,并为每个角色分配特定的权限。当用户登录成功后,系统会自动为其分配相应的角色和权限。
管理员登录页面
与普通用户不同,管理员登录页面通常需要更加严格的身份验证机制。除了用户名和密码,管理员登录页面还可以增加验证码、双因素认证等安全措施,以提高系统的安全性。
在权限管理方面,管理员通常拥有最高级别的权限,可以对系统的各项功能进行配置和管理。这包括但不限于:用户管理、角色管理、权限分配、系统设置等。管理员可以根据实际需求,灵活调整不同用户角色的权限,以确保系统的安全性和稳定性。
总结
通过本文的介绍,相信您已经对ASP.NET登录页面的用户和管理员权限划分有了更深入的了解。合理的权限管理不仅可以提高系统的安全性,还能够为用户提供更加优质的使用体验。希望本文对您的ASP.NET开发工作有所帮助。感谢您的阅读!